Cumby ISD Calls Bond Election

Cumby ISD called a $6.2 million bond election for May 2. Money raised will be used for renovations and improvements at the elementary campus, related construction, and remodeling.

Upshur County Death Under Investigation

Upshur County Deputies are investigating the death of a man who was found fatally shot late last week. They identified the victim as 18-year-old Jonathon Christopher Johnson, of Big Sandy. Investigators are actively working with other agencies to follow up leads in the case.
